#pragma once
#include <string>
#include <memory>
#include <Windows.h>
#include <windows.ui.notifications.h>
#include <wrl.h>
#define TOAST_ACTIVATED_LAUNCH_ARG L"-ToastActivated"
using namespace ABI::Windows::UI::Notifications;
class DesktopNotificationHistoryCompat;
namespace DesktopNotificationManagerCompat
{
/// <summary>
/// If not running under the Desktop Bridge, you must call this method to register your AUMID with the Compat library and to
/// register your COM CLSID and EXE in LocalServer32 registry. Feel free to call this regardless, and we will no-op if running
/// under Desktop Bridge. Call this upon application startup, before calling any other APIs.
/// </summary>
/// <param name="aumid">An AUMID that uniquely identifies your application.</param>
/// <param name="clsid">The CLSID of your NotificationActivator class.</param>
HRESULT RegisterAumidAndComServer(const wchar_t *aumid, GUID clsid);
/// <summary>
/// Registers your module to handle COM activations. Call this upon application startup.
/// </summary>
HRESULT RegisterActivator();
/// <summary>
/// Creates a toast notifier. You must have called RegisterActivator first (and also RegisterAumidAndComServer if you're a classic Win32 app), or this will throw an exception.
/// </summary>
HRESULT CreateToastNotifier(IToastNotifier** notifier);
/// <summary>
/// Creates an XmlDocument initialized with the specified string. This is simply a convenience helper method.
/// </summary>
HRESULT CreateXmlDocumentFromString(const wchar_t *xmlString, ABI::Windows::Data::Xml::Dom::IXmlDocument** doc);
/// <summary>
/// Creates a toast notification. This is simply a convenience helper method.
/// </summary>
HRESULT CreateToastNotification(ABI::Windows::Data::Xml::Dom::IXmlDocument* content, IToastNotification** notification);
/// <summary>
/// Gets the DesktopNotificationHistoryCompat object. You must have called RegisterActivator first (and also RegisterAumidAndComServer if you're a classic Win32 app), or this will throw an exception.
/// </summary>
HRESULT get_History(std::unique_ptr<DesktopNotificationHistoryCompat>* history);
/// <summary>
/// Gets a boolean representing whether http images can be used within toasts. This is true if running under Desktop Bridge.
/// </summary>
bool CanUseHttpImages();
}
class DesktopNotificationHistoryCompat
{
public:
/// <summary>
/// Removes all notifications sent by this app from action center.
/// </summary>
HRESULT Clear();
/// <summary>
/// Gets all notifications sent by this app that are currently still in Action Center.
/// </summary>
HRESULT GetHistory(ABI::Windows::Foundation::Collections::IVectorView<ToastNotification*>** history);
/// <summary>
/// Removes an individual toast, with the specified tag label, from action center.
/// </summary>
/// <param name="tag">The tag label of the toast notification to be removed.</param>
HRESULT Remove(const wchar_t *tag);
/// <summary>
/// Removes a toast notification from the action using the notification's tag and group labels.
/// </summary>
/// <param name="tag">The tag label of the toast notification to be removed.</param>
/// <param name="group">The group label of the toast notification to be removed.</param>
HRESULT RemoveGroupedTag(const wchar_t *tag, const wchar_t *group);
/// <summary>
/// Removes a group of toast notifications, identified by the specified group label, from action center.
/// </summary>
/// <param name="group">The group label of the toast notifications to be removed.</param>
HRESULT RemoveGroup(const wchar_t *group);
/// <summary>
/// Do not call this. Instead, call DesktopNotificationManagerCompat.get_History() to obtain an instance.
/// </summary>
DesktopNotificationHistoryCompat(const wchar_t *aumid, Microsoft::WRL::ComPtr<IToastNotificationHistory> history);
private:
std::wstring m_aumid;
Microsoft::WRL::ComPtr<IToastNotificationHistory> m_history = nullptr;
};

// dllmain.cpp : Defines the entry point for the DLL application.
#define WIN32_LEAN_AND_MEAN // Exclude rarely-used stuff from Windows headers
#include <windows.h>
#include <NotificationActivationCallback.h>
#include <windows.ui.notifications.h>
#include <wrl/wrappers/corewrappers.h>
#include "DesktopToasts.h"
#include "DesktopNotificationManagerCompat.h"
#define RETURN_IF_FAILED(hr) do { HRESULT _hrTemp = hr; if (FAILED(_hrTemp)) { return _hrTemp; } } while (false)
using namespace ABI::Windows::Data::Xml::Dom;
using namespace ABI::Windows::UI::Notifications;
using namespace Microsoft::WRL;
using namespace Microsoft::WRL::Wrappers;
DesktopToastActivateHandler g_handler = nullptr;
void* g_handlerContext = nullptr;
class DECLSPEC_UUID("E407B70A-1FBD-4D5E-8822-231C69102472") NotificationActivator WrlSealed WrlFinal
: public RuntimeClass<RuntimeClassFlags<ClassicCom>, INotificationActivationCallback>
{
public:
virtual HRESULT STDMETHODCALLTYPE Activate(
_In_ LPCWSTR appUserModelId,
_In_ LPCWSTR invokedArgs,
_In_reads_(dataCount) const NOTIFICATION_USER_INPUT_DATA * data,
ULONG dataCount) override
{
if (g_handler)
g_handler(g_handlerContext, invokedArgs);
return S_OK;
}
};
// Flag class as COM creatable
CoCreatableClass(NotificationActivator);
HRESULT Initialize(LPCWSTR appUserModelId, DesktopToastActivateHandler handler, void* handlerContext)
{
RETURN_IF_FAILED(DesktopNotificationManagerCompat::RegisterAumidAndComServer(appUserModelId, __uuidof(NotificationActivator)));
RETURN_IF_FAILED(DesktopNotificationManagerCompat::RegisterActivator());
g_handler = handler;
g_handlerContext = handlerContext;
return S_OK;
}
HRESULT SetNodeValueString(HSTRING inputString, IXmlNode* node, IXmlDocument* xml)
{
ComPtr<IXmlText> inputText;
RETURN_IF_FAILED(xml->CreateTextNode(inputString, &inputText));
ComPtr<IXmlNode> inputTextNode;
RETURN_IF_FAILED(inputText.As(&inputTextNode));
ComPtr<IXmlNode> appendedChild;
return node->AppendChild(inputTextNode.Get(), &appendedChild);
}
_Use_decl_annotations_
HRESULT SetTextValues(const PCWSTR* textValues, UINT32 textValuesCount, IXmlDocument* toastXml)
{
ComPtr<IXmlNodeList> nodeList;
RETURN_IF_FAILED(toastXml->GetElementsByTagName(HStringReference(L"text").Get(), &nodeList));
UINT32 nodeListLength;
RETURN_IF_FAILED(nodeList->get_Length(&nodeListLength));
// If a template was chosen with fewer text elements, also change the amount of strings
// passed to this method.
RETURN_IF_FAILED(textValuesCount <= nodeListLength ? S_OK : E_INVALIDARG);
for (UINT32 i = 0; i < textValuesCount; i++)
{
ComPtr<IXmlNode> textNode;
RETURN_IF_FAILED(nodeList->Item(i, &textNode));
RETURN_IF_FAILED(SetNodeValueString(HStringReference(textValues[i]).Get(), textNode.Get(), toastXml));
}
return S_OK;
}
HRESULT DisplaySimpleToast(LPCWSTR title, LPCWSTR text)
{
// Construct XML
ComPtr<IXmlDocument> doc;
HRESULT hr = DesktopNotificationManagerCompat::CreateXmlDocumentFromString(L"<toast><visual><binding template='ToastGeneric'><text></text><text></text></binding></visual></toast>", &doc);
if (SUCCEEDED(hr))
{
PCWSTR textValues[] = { title, text };
SetTextValues(textValues, ARRAYSIZE(textValues), doc.Get());
// Create the notifier
// Classic Win32 apps MUST use the compat method to create the notifier
ComPtr<IToastNotifier> notifier;
hr = DesktopNotificationManagerCompat::CreateToastNotifier(&notifier);
if (SUCCEEDED(hr))
{
// Create the notification itself (using helper method from compat library)
ComPtr<IToastNotification> toast;
hr = DesktopNotificationManagerCompat::CreateToastNotification(doc.Get(), &toast);
if (SUCCEEDED(hr))
{
// And show it!
hr = notifier->Show(toast.Get());
}
}
}
return hr;
}
